Lakers fall to Cuyahoga

The Lakers baseball team traveled to Cuyahoga Community College on Sunday to face the Triceratops. Unfortunately for the Lakers, they dropped both ends of the doubleheader by the scores of 8-5 and 5-3. Both games had a similar feel as the Lakers held leads late before making a costly mistake that opened the door for Tri-C. In game 1, Dalton Vance got things going with a leadoff double. He would later score on a 1-out RBI single from Rafael Nakandakari Alves. Alves would then score on an RBI single from Kyle Zaluski. Later in the inning, Seth Cervello would hit an RBI single to score Zaluski to open a 3-0 Laker lead after a half innng of play. Tri-C would answer by scoring 2 runs without a hit as they took advantage of 3 walks and a HBP to score runs on a sac fly and a fielder's choice. Tri-C would knot the score at 3 in the bottom of the 2nd inning before the Lakers regained the lead in the top of the 3rd inning. Zaluski would hit a lead-off single and come around to score an unearned run. The Lakers would extend their lead to 5-3 in the 4th inning as Cody Hjduk would reach by being hit by a pitch and then race all the way around to score on an Alves double. Tri-C would narrow the lead to 5-4 in the bottom of the 5th as they scored a run on a passed ball. Tri-C then won the game in the bottom of the 7th as they took advantage of a Lakeland error before hitting a walk off home run. Kyle Zaluski went 3-3 with 2 runs scored and an RBI. Rafael Nakandakari Alves and Dalton Vance both finished the game going 2-4 (double, single) with a run scored. Alves also added 2 RBI's. Cody Hejduk, Seth Cervello, Austin Heeter, and Cody Crawford each went 1-3 in the loss. Seena Amani took the loss on the mound pitching 6.1 innings scattering 6 hits while allowing 8 runs (7 earned), Amani also struck out 6 batters.

In game 2, the Lakers again got off to a good start in the top of the 1st inning. Cody Hejduk drew a walk before Rafael Nakandakari Alves singled. Kyle Zaluski then ripped a 2-RBI triple to give the Lakers the early 2-0 lead. That score would remain until the top of the 4th inning when the Lakers tacked on another run. Seth Cervello hit a 1-out double and then scored on an RBI single from Cody Crawford. Tri-C would scratch a run across in the bottom of the 4th and 5th innings to make the score 3-2 in favor of the Lakers. The 4th inning run was paced by a walk while the run in the 5th saw the Triceratops take advantage of a Laker error. Tri-C would then take the lead for good scoring 3 runs in the bottom of the 6th inning. A pair of walks paired with two hits led to the runs. Kyle Zaluski and Rafael Nakandakari Alves both went 2-3 in the night cap. Zaluski also recorded 2-RBI's. Cody Crawford went 1-3 with an RBI while Seth Cervello finished the game going 1-2. Abe Bayus took the tough luck loss tossing 5.1 innngs and allowing just 3 hits while giving up 5 runs (4 earned) and striking out 4 batters. Frank Sloan relieved Bayus in the 6th inning and pitched .2 innings allowing 1 hit.
